Inside the ionization chamber the remaining molecules—a combination from the cell period elements and solutes—endure ionization and fragmentation. The mass spectrometer’s mass analyzer separates the ions by their mass-to-charge ratio (m/z). A detector counts the ions and shows the mass spectrum.

Size Exclusion Chromatographic columns different molecules dependent upon their sizing, not molecular body weight. A typical packing materials for these columns is molecular sieves. Zeolites are a standard molecular sieve that is definitely employed. The molecular sieves have pores that tiny molecules can go into, but big molecules simply cannot.

In this kind of hplc a revese period coloumn (nonpolar) is temporarily transformed into ion exchange. This really is performed through the use of ion pairing agents like pentane, hexane, heptane or octane sulphonic acids salts.

Gasoline samples are collected by bubbling them via a entice that contains a suitable solvent. Natural isocyanates in industrial atmospheres are collected by bubbling the air as a result of a solution of 1-(2-methoxyphenyl)piperazine in toluene. The reaction involving the isocyanates and one-(two-methoxyphenyl)piperazine both of those stabilizes them towards degradation before the HPLC Examination and converts them to your chemical form that may be monitored by UV absorption.
